The board of the Log Cabin Republicans Chicago chapter is appalled by statements made by Illinois U.S. Senate Candidate Alan Keyes. Speaking at an anti-gay marriage rally in Chicago’s Marquette Park on Oct 16, Keyes said that incest is ‘inevitable’ for the children of gay and lesbian parents.
This message is the latest in a series of comments that has outraged the group, including when Keyes called homosexuals ‘selfish hedonists.’ The Log Cabins consider Keyes’ comments to be ‘outrageous, unfounded and very painful to Illinois gays and lesbians, especially those with children.’ The rally in Marquette Park was part of a statewide ‘United We Stand—Defending Marriage’ bus tour.
‘Alan Keyes should apologize for his statement immediately. … Voters from the state of Lincoln and Reagan deserve a better candidate than someone from another state who uses his campaign as a platform to insult Illinois residents,’ the Log Cabin statement reads.
The Chicago Log Cabin Republicans is the Illinois chapter of the Log Cabin Republicans based in Washington D.C.
